Differential Pressure Control Valves webinar – join us!

On the 14th June, HVR is inviting you to join Frese UK’s webinar on the function, application, benefits and considerations when using Differential Pressure Control Valves (DPCVs) in variable flow hydronic (waterborne) heating and cooling systems.

The webinar is being given by Stephen Hart, managing director and co-owner of Frese UK. Since entering the building services industry in 2000, he has travelled extensively presenting the features and benefits of pressure independent temperature control valve solutions in more than 30 countries.

Whether you’re yet to use DPVCs or you’re interested in learning more about how to use them to the best of their ability, then this is the seminar for you.
